Output 397499a237d95e06fbfca433d46f94772940b2930a6750eb314240f7df496bb2:143

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11ad20bb4eeb59a12537f7a39e0bf1e26145d4f OP_EQUAL
address
3LkfHA3QghUYZZMH2SErpuaEibz5fag8jQ
transaction
397499a237d95e06fbfca433d46f94772940b2930a6750eb314240f7df496bb2
confirmations
64348
spent
true